Which of the following oxide of elements is more basic in nature?
Correct answer: A. K2O
- A. K2O
- B. MgO
- C. CaO
- D. Al2O3
Explanation
To determine the basic nature of oxides, we look at the elements' positions in the periodic table. Metals to the left and towards the bottom are more basic. Potassium (K) is an alkali metal, and its oxide K2O is highly basic. Magnesium oxide (MgO) and calcium oxide (CaO) are alkaline earth metal oxides, which are basic but not as strong as alkali metal oxides. Aluminum oxide (Al2O3) is a metalloid oxide that can exhibit both acidic and basic properties. Therefore, K2O is the most basic oxide among the options provided.
